Why This Matters: Accurate and well-scoped representations align expectations and enable remedies for misstatements, reducing the likelihood of costly disputes.
Negotiation strategy
If you're the Company:
Ensure representations are precise and supported by disclosure schedules. Negotiate for a longer survival period to cover potential post-closing issues.
If you're the Advisor:
Limit the scope of representations to avoid overcommitment. Aim for a shorter survival period to minimize ongoing liability.

Example clauses
FAVORABLE
Preferred Survival Period
"The representations and warranties shall survive the closing for a period of 18 months, except in cases of fraud or intentional misrepresentation."
NEUTRAL
Standard Representations and Warranties
"Each party represents and warrants to the other party as follows: Organization and Authority, Compliance with Laws, No Conflicts, Disclosure Schedules, Survival Period."
UNFAVORABLE
Overly Broad Representations
"Each party represents and warrants compliance with all laws, without limitation or disclosure."
Fallbacks
High-Risk Projects
In high-risk projects, extend the survival period and ensure detailed disclosures to mitigate potential liabilities.
Regulated Industries
Include additional representations specific to regulatory compliance and industry standards for transactions involving regulated industries.
Cross-Border Transactions
Address jurisdiction-specific compliance and conflict of laws to ensure enforceability across borders.
